Shopify and WooCommerce represent fundamentally different approaches to e-commerce. Shopify is a fully hosted platform starting at $29/month (annual) for its Basic plan, scaling up to $399/month for Advanced. WooCommerce is a free, open-source WordPress plugin where costs come primarily from hosting, ranging from $0 for self-hosted setups to around $70/month for managed WooCommerce hosting. The total cost of ownership differs significantly depending on your technical expertise and customization needs.

Our Verdict
Choose Shopify if you want an all-in-one hosted solution with minimal technical overhead, reliable uptime, and built-in payment processing -- plans start at $29/month annually and include hosting, security, and support. Choose WooCommerce if you want full control over your store with lower baseline costs, especially if you already have WordPress experience -- the plugin itself is free, and shared hosting starts at just $20-25/month.
Frequently Asked Questions
01 Is WooCommerce cheaper than Shopify?
WooCommerce can be significantly cheaper since the plugin itself is free and shared hosting starts around $20-25/month, compared to Shopify's Basic plan at $29/month (annual billing) or $39/month paid monthly. However, WooCommerce costs can add up quickly when you factor in premium themes, extensions, SSL certificates, and security plugins, potentially matching or exceeding Shopify's pricing.
02 Which is better for small businesses just starting out?
Shopify is generally better for beginners and small businesses that want to start selling quickly without technical complexity. Its Basic plan at $29/month (annually) includes everything needed to launch a store. WooCommerce is better for budget-conscious businesses with some technical skills, as it offers a free starting point with self-hosted setups.
03 Can WooCommerce replace Shopify?
Yes, WooCommerce can replace Shopify for most e-commerce use cases, though it requires more hands-on management. WooCommerce offers greater flexibility and customization since it is open-source, and its total cost can range from $0 to $200/month depending on your hosting and extension choices. However, you will need to handle your own hosting, security updates, and maintenance, which Shopify includes in its $29-$399/month plans.
